I have always loved art.

After having four children and semi-retiring from nursing, I found some time to return to the world of art. I attended a watercolour class instructed by Susan Chater at The Fred Varley Gallery. That inspired me to take more workshops, join the Schoolhouse Group of Artists and the Toronto Watercolour Society. I have also attended art classes at the Halliburton School of Art, Loyalist College and studied under Hy Sook Barker.

I feel so lucky to be part of this wonderful art community. It’s a great way to share ideas, be inspired and learn new techniques. I favour painting in watercolour and experimenting with other mediums. The possibilities are endless!
